Stuck Handles
A problem with the handle or mechanism is likely to be the primary blame for a stuck uPVC. These mechanisms can be repaired in a relatively quick time, ensuring that windows will continue to function as they should. To avoid any issues it is crucial to clean and maintain upvc window repair (navigate to this web-site) Windows.
The most common uPVC window handles employed are espagnolette handles. They are equipped with a multipoint locking system which enhances the security of the window, with mushroom-like locking cams that lock into the window frame keeps. The handle is generally able to open or close the window without difficulty. However, if the handle is stuck it could be due to an issue with the spindle in the handle.
It is a good thing that replacing a window handle made of uPVC is a relatively simple task that can be undertaken by anyone with a basic set of tools and the necessary skills. To successfully replace a handle you need to identify the type of handle you want to replace and then measure the spindle. Then, purchase a replacement handle that is exactly the same size as the current one. The process shouldn't take more than 30 minutes after you have the proper tools and the replacement part.
